Nowadays brings more possibly noteworthy gushing commerce news, with the entry of a new Spotify challenger from an as of now set up player within the sound division: US adj. radio benefit SiriusXM.
At an occasion in New York today, SiriusXM reported a rebrand, counting a unused symbol (the moment company within the gushing commerce to do so this week).
SiriusXM too revealed a new streaming app and a new ‘Streaming All Get to Plan’ for $9.99 a month, which the company says is “aimed at inviting in a new era of SiriusXM listeners”.
According to SiriusXM, the app “will offer audience members a more personalized, easy-to-use, lean-back streaming encounter that puts disclosure at the forefront”.
The new app will include four curated sections including a customized For You landing page for each audience, as well as Music, Talk & Podcasts, and Sports.
The app too sees SiriusXM revamp its playback functionality, with a modern media player optimized for each sort of content; upgraded search capabilities, and an extended podcast library. It also highlights a Central Audio Library with modern offline tuning in and download capabilities.
As famous by the Skirt, ‘The result is something that works and looks a parcel more like Spotify’ with the new app speaking to ‘the most critical attempt’ by the company to solidify its podcast, music, and conversation offerings.
SiriusXM obtained music spilling benefit Pandora in 2019 in a $3.5 billion all-stock exchange, and Podcast stage Stitcher for over $300 million the taking after year.

With the dispatch of the modern app following month, the company will be presenting modern ‘guest DJ channel takeovers’ from over 160 well known specialists and groups, extending from Olivia Rodrigo and Cardi B to Alice Cooper and Luke Combs.
The app declaration and rebrand take after the news from final week that SiriusXM’s Pandora misplaced 112,000 supporters in Q3, whereas its partisan benefit lost 94,000. (Spotify’s worldwide Premium Endorser base developed to 226 million paying clients in Q3, adding 6 million during the quarter.)
SiriusXM’s new app starts rolling out within the App Store, Google Play, and on Amazon Fire devices on December 14 with additional platforms and features to come in early 2024.
